      Virginia Military Festival

      Friday April 19-Sunday April 21, 2024

      “Words cannot explain the Virginia International Tattoo other than to say it's the most amazing and inspiring gathering of military bands, drill teams, and performers from the U.S. service branches and from militaries around the world. It gave me goosebumps and brought tears to my eyes. I see why it was chosen to be the best of American Bus Association's Top 100 Events in North America!"

      Peter Pantuso, President/ CEO, American Bus Association

      Begin your patriotic adventure aboard the Victory Rover Cruising through the bustling Hampton Roads Harbor, one of the largest in the world. Enjoy fascinating and entertaining commentary during the two-hour excursion aboard this naval themed vessel. Take in the sights of aircraft carriers, nuclear submarines, guided cruisers and all of the other ships that form the world's most powerful armada. A boxed dinner will be served picnic style during the cruise.  After the cruise you will check in to the Hyatt House Virginia Beach Oceanfront.  The celebration continues on Saturday morning. Following breakfast at the hotel, you will head downtown for an early visit to Nauticus, a nautical museum, where you will learn about the power of the sea, experience ship handling first hand and pet a shark. Visit the museum and then enjoy a self-guided tour of the Battleship Wisconsin—the largest battleship that served in WWII, the Korean War and the Persian Gulf War. Walk the short distance for reserved seating at the Parade of Nations which features marching bands, Tattoo performers, dazzling floats and decorated NATO officials, all representing NATO nations. Walk the short distance to Town Point Park for NATO Fest, a cultural experience of food, drink and entertainment. The 28 NATO countries will showcase unique cultures in a festival-style format. You can take in the sights and sounds while enjoying lunch on your own from the many international offerings.  Depart for hotel for some down time. Prior to the evening excitement you will enjoy dinner before a fun-filled night at The Virginia International Tattoo beginning with Hullabaloo, featuring performances by a variety of musicians, dancers and drill teams. Then it’s on to the main event—the Tattoo, the largest in the United States.

      After breakfast and check-out, spend the morning at the Norfolk Botanical Gardens in full bloom. Take a trackless tram to explore 155-acres of rare flowers, mature forests and one of the largest collections of azaleas, camellias, and roses on the East Coast.   Depart Norfolk with fond memories of your time in Coastal Virginia.  A stop will be made for lunch on the return.

      Package includes motor coach transportation, overnight accommodations at Hyatt House Virginia Beach, two breakfasts, two dinners, guided tours, admissions, driver’s gratuity and trip leader.
